not too much trigger time w/ 00 Buck thru a Patternmaster tube, but lots of steel "T" and steel "BBB" for snow geese & Canada Geese and #7-1/2 lead on doves, pigeons, rabbits, pheasants, crows & more
I had the tube in my old Remington 1100 3" magnum 12 gauge, the Patternmaster made a world of difference in performance, the wads would drop very quickly after leaving the muzzle and would not punch holes in the shot pattern, I would make unbelievable shots that my friends would not believe if they would not have seen with their own eyes
I tried a Patternmaster tube with my Winchester SX2 when I first bought the SX2, but I did not have the same performance as I did w/ the 1100, I believe that was due to the SX2 barrel being over bored (or is it back-bored)
thats my limited experience w/ a Patternmaster tube
